Transaction 642720ae4da6dafc5ff1d076c9912789686c99b51706864f754155dfba504a2a

1 Input
1 Outputs
  • 642720ae4da6dafc5ff1d076c9912789686c99b51706864f754155dfba504a2a:0
  • value  112367
    address  3BbydXYJP5S6HYGncb54AnZpTaUGadAuB4